COVID-19 Risk Assessment
Carried out by Tiffany Hair & Beauty at Bridge Street, Aberdeen, AB11 6JL updated on 31 October 2020.
Risks will be reviewed and updated on an ongoing basis.
RISK TYPE
Reception area, cross contamination through bookings, arrival and payments.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- When possible, keep the salon door locked. Do not enter the salon until the receptionist unlocks the door, making it safe for you to enter.
- Appointments must be made in advance either by our online booking system or email or telephone. No walk-in appointments.
- Clients to be told before arriving for appointment about changes by way of email, or referred to our website.
- Clients will be asked to cancel if they feel unwell.
- Arrive into the salon wearing a mask.
- Arrive with a minimal size bag/jacket. We cannot hang up your jacket nor take your bag. You will be provided with a bag to put your jacket/bag into and keep with you at your position.
- A sneeze guard has been fitted to our reception desk for the purpose of payments by card machine.
- Payments to be made by card where possible, and a strict process has been devised for making sure no cross contamination from using pinpad.
- No cash payments unless no alternative.
- Floor marking at reception for guidance on where to stand at a safe distance.
- Reception and waiting area disinfected regularly including door handles.
- Receptionist to take all bills, staff to leave clients and not to stand at reception.
Action to be taken:
- Make sure PPE is available at all times.
- Each client will be provided with a PPE kit upon arrival (a charge will be levied according to the kit required for the service carried out eg cutting, or colouring etc)
- Clients will be asked to remove their own mask and wear the mask provided in their PPE kit.
- Antibacterial hand gel available for all clients and staff.
RISK TYPE
Cross contamination at the backwash area.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- All staff to wear visors and PPE
- All clients to wear masks and PPE
- Only 3 basins used at any one time (leaving a basin non-operational between each operational basin)
- All basins, taps, and seats to be disinfected after each use.
- Staff to guide the client to the backwash using the route map to get from your position to the backwash area.
- Either one fresh laundered towel or one disposable towel to be used for each client.
- Staff to wash or sanitize hands before and after using the backwash area.
Actions to be taken:
- Cleaning products to be available at the backwash area at all times
RISK TYPE
Cross contamination at the cutting/colouring positions.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- Clients to be seated in designated seats so social distancing measures are applied.
- Clients wear masks at all times.
- Client will be provided with a disposable gown in their PPE pack. This must be taken away by the client at the end of the service and can be brought back to be reused as a gown for life, whilst it is still usable.
- Staff to wear visor, disposable aprons and gloves where possible.
- Each stylist has their designated position and work station.
- All equipment eg cutting, drying, brushes, products will be sterilised using specialist products after each client.
- Position and chair will be cleaned and sterilized between each client.
- Trolley and stools to be sanitized after each use.
- Cutting collars to be sanitized after each use.
Actions to be taken:
- PPE to be available
- Cleaning stations throughout the salon
RISK TYPE
Client resources spreading Covid-19.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- No teas or coffees will be provided
- Water can be provided in a disposable cup, but preferable for clients to bring their own bottled water.
- All magazines and leaflets to be removed from the salon.
- All information regarding service prices will be provided on our website.
RISK TYPE
Contamination in toilets and wash areas.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- Toilets to be disinfected on a regular basis
- Hand soap, hand sanitizer, disposable paper towels provided at all times
- Bins emptied regularly
Actions to be taken:
- Disinfectant spray to be used on door handles, toilet seat, flush handle, sink and taps.
RISK TYPE
Overcrowding in the salon, being unable to social distance.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- Less stylists/juniors allocated to any one shift.
- Number of clients will be limited on the premises at any one time, and must observe social distancing at all times.
- Clients asked to arrive on time. Don’t be too early and don’t be late. (If a client is late, they risk having their appointment cancelled and may still be charged).
- Clients asked to arrive alone.
- Children will not be allowed in the salon unless having a service done.
Actions to be taken:
- Client numbers in the salon will be monitored at all times, and may have to wait outside for their appointment if a stylist is running behind.
RISK TYPE
Lack of PPE
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- Levels of PPE should be monitored daily to make sure levels are kept high.
- This will be the responsibility of all staff.
- Clients will be asked to arrive with their own mask, but to switch to wearing the mask provided by the salon in their PPE kit.
- Clients will be provided with disposable gown, cape, gloves, and towel (in accordance with the requirements for the service they are booked for).
- A PPE charge will be added to all bills to cover the PPE costs.
Actions to be taken:
- Stock list for PPE to be created.
- Set up billing on the till for relevant PPE kit/s.
RISK TYPE
Inappropriate cleaning and hygiene
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- Salon, doors, handles, surfaces, and toilets to be disinfected regularly.
- All salon work spaces to be cleaned after every client.
- All hair kits to be sterilised after each client using barbicide sprays.
- Staff to have clean clothing/uniform daily, to have clean hair daily, and tie up if possible.
- Staff to wash hands regularly throughout the day.
- Staff arrive in plenty of time to get into PPE each day.
- Staff visors to be cleaned daily with appropriate spray and microfibre cloth.
- Staff PPE to remain in the salon, not to be worn out of the salon, nor taken home.

RISK TYPE
Staff belongings and break/lunch arrangements not followed
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- All staff belongings will be stored in the staffroom to stop cross contamination.
- Food and drinks are not permitted on the salon floor, nor in colours areas, nor in any area where client services are carried out.
- All breaks must be taken in the staffroom or outside of the salon and social distance. Do not wear salon PPE outside of the salon.
- If using the kitchen area staff must disinfect the area and wash all dishes in the dishwasher or in hot soapy water.
- Hands must be washed before re-entering the salon/client floor area and clean PPE used.
- All staff should try to social distance as much as possible.
- Phones are not permitted on the salon floor.
- No personal deliveries to the salon is permitted.
Actions to be taken:
- Cleaning products available at all times.
- PPE to be available at all times.
RISK TYPE
Suspect Covid 19 or illness in staff.
Measures to Minimise Risk to staff and clients:
- All staff will be asked not to come to work if they feel unwell.
- If any staff member has symptoms of Covid 19 they will be asked to self-isolate for 7 days or be tested if possible.
- If symptoms of Covid 19 start at work, staff members will be asked to go straight home or go into the staff room on their own to self-isolate until they can leave the premises.
- All areas the staff member has been will then be deep cleaned.
